Here
is a precious truth for thee, believer. Thou mayest be poor, or in suffering,
or unknown, but for thine encouragement take a review of thy "calling"
and the consequences that flow from it, and especially that blessed
result here spoken of. As surely as thou art God's child today, so surely
shall all thy trials soon be at an end, and thou shalt be rich to all
the intents of bliss. Wait awhile, and that weary head shall wear the
crown of glory, and that hand of labour shall grasp the palm-branch
of victory. Lament not thy troubles, but rather rejoice that ere long
thou wilt be where "there shall be neither sorrow, nor crying,
neither shall there be any more pain." The chariots of fire are
at thy door, and a moment will suffice to bear thee to the glorified.
The everlasting song is almost on thy lip. The portals of heaven stand
open for thee. Think not that thou canst fail of entering into rest.
If He hath called thee, nothing can divide thee from His love. Distress
cannot sever the bond; the fire of persecution cannot burn the link;
the hammer of hell cannot break the chain. Thou art secure; that voice
which called thee at first, shall call thee yet again from earth to
heaven, from death's dark gloom to immortality's unuttered splendours.
Rest assured, the heart of Him who has justified thee beats with infinite
love towards thee. Thou shalt soon be with the glorified, where thy
portion is; thou art only waiting here to be made meet for the inheritance,
and that done, the wings of angels shall waft thee far away, to the
mount of peace, and joy, and blessedness, where, "Far
